Problem
STEM education relies heavily on visual content - graphs, diagrams, chemical structures. Visually impaired students miss critical learning because these images lack proper descriptions.
Solution
Extended RAVI with STEM-specific capabilities: chemical structure recognition, graph interpretation, equation rendering, and context-aware descriptions that explain WHY an image is important, not just WHAT it shows.
